The mountain man hollowed out a pile of snow and slept warmer than most people reading this have ever been in a tent, because he understood something about snow that we have completely lost. Snow is not one thing. Some of it will save you. Some of it lies. In this video, I dig into how the old trappers — and the Athabaskan peoples who carried this knowledge long before them — learned to read the snowpack the way most people read a map. The weak, sugary layer that collapses the moment you trust it. The loose powder that welds itself solid if you give it two hours and walk away. The hard, wind-driven snow that builds strong but bleeds warmth. And the move almost nobody makes: scraping down to bare earth and letting the ground itself work for you. This is one of the most counterintuitive survival skills in cold country. The wall keeping him alive was made of the very thing trying to kill him.
